This is from the syndicated TV special about Creedence that ran in (I think) '71. There is no listing for it on imdb, but I recall this Booker T. footage, and another scene where Creedence is sitting in a limo and a fan pokes his head through a window, and wants to share whatever he's got in his bottle, and they decline with sort of a "we're straight...we don't do drugs/alcohol" explanation.

Which at the time, seemed pretty unconventional. Weird in fact.

I have been to the Stax museum in Memphis. Worth a trip for anyone in town. They have done an excellent job at restoring the original building (which I believe had burned down). The exhibits are great and include the organ Booker T. played on the "Green Onions" session, as well as one of the original reel-to-reel four track tape recorders from the studio.
